     WRIT PETITION Nos.20094, 20126 & 20753 of 2020

COMMON ORDER :
       These writ petitions are filed seeking to declare the

action of respondent-authorities in not extending the benefit

of Rule of Reservation to the employees belonging to the

Scheduled Caste and Scheduled Tribes hailing from the State

of Andhra Pradesh, as illegal and arbitrary.


2.     Heard both sides.


3.     It is represented by both sides that the subject matter

involved in these writ petitions is squarely covered by a

Division Bench judgment of this Court in W.P.No.4288 of

2021, dated 20.07.2021.


4.     In view of the above, for the reasons recorded in the

aforesaid order, these writ petitions are allowed and the

respondents are directed to consider the cases of petitioners

for promotion with all consequential benefits, within four

weeks from today.
                                2



5.    However, it is made clear that the costs of Rs.50,000/-

imposed in the order dated 20.07.2021 in W.P.No.4288 of

2021, are not imposed in these writ petitions.


6.    Accordingly, these writ petitions are allowed. No order

as to costs.


      Pending miscellaneous applications, if any, shall stand

closed.
